Favorite and least favorite Ubers generations?

Favourite: Gen 8 ubers. There's a very large variety of playstyles - 3 viable weathers, hazard stacking, balance, screens and webs. I think that it can be difficult to build as a result of having to account for so many playstyles, but with careful key plays, bad MUs can be completely turned around which really keeps the meta fun and fresh.
Least favourite: I haven't played Ubers prior to gen 7 much, but my least favourite is probably oras because of how powerful offense is. Threats like Xerneas, primal groudon, mence, rai are just too powerful. The tier isn't too accessible to new players imo, I think it really takes a lot of skill to build your own good ORAS teams rather than just grabbing broken HO.

Thoughts on the current state of SS? Excited for the next DLC?

SS ubers is in a decent state right now. Dynamax is broken though, oftentimes you just have to outplay them in order to beat their dynamaxers, as it is impossible to prepare for them all. KB, gyarados, cinderace, pult + the weather abusers are scary, but with DLC 2 it'll just get worse with kart, lando, zyg. I think DLC 2 will be a pretty unbalanced meta without Support Arceus though, and might turn out extremely offensive but hopefully I am proven wrong.

What do you think about the current Dynamax restrictions? Do you think it should be altered ?

Definitely. It's definitely consensus between ubers players that Dynamax is broken - even with a banlist and I think it's a matter of when it will be banned rather than if. There's only really two acceptable things to be done imo: expand the banlist enormously, or ban the entire mechanic. The first option is largely not very possible due to the number of suspects which will be required. DLC 2 will just overwhelm that system.

Do you have a favorite playstyle to use in Ubers?

My favourite playstyle in all tiers is balance. It's the most flexible playstyle and has nearly no instant loss matchups (even the worst MUs are outplayable). Balance containing breakers such as Lunala or Dracovish is just really nice as either is able to pretty much dismantle any defensive cores given you predict well, which makes winning with them really satisfying.

AG and Ubers are very often compared and its not uncommon for an AG player to find great success in Ubers, what do you think is the biggest difference between the tiers? Any thoughts on the Zacian-Crowned vs Mega Rayquaza discussions?

The greatest difference between USUM AG and Ubers is definitely the presence of multiple Arceus formes, and Rayquaza-Mega. The effect of these can be seen in pokemon like Primal-Kyogre (A+ Ubers, A- AG) and Yveltal (S- Ubers, A- AG) being far worse than they are in Ubers. This gen there are 2 AG formats really, Galar AG and National Dex AG. Galar AG's main difference compared with Galar Ubers is Dynamax, which is just so broken. Necrozma-Dusk-Mane is broken beyond belief and imo is better than Mega Rayquaza ever was. National Dex AG is a completely different thing, and is more comparable to USUM Ubers but + Zacian-C, Eternatus and Dynamax. Ironically, National Dex AG is more balanced than Galar AG. When most people think of AG, they probably think of Spore/BP/OHKO/Evasion, but these are extremely uncommon strats to find in tournament games or even just above 1700 on the ladder because of how inconsistent they are.

Zacian-Crowned is definitely more viable and splashable than Mega Rayquaza, but Mega Rayquaza is certainly more "broken". Zacian-C functions as an extremely good offensive check and sweeper, but Mega Rayquaza is a far more powerful wallbreaker and is much more nightmarish in the teambuilder given that no true counters exist, unlike for Zacian. Rayquaza also has a high level of bulk and is a great revenger as well as sweeper. It's like comparing Dragapult and Dracovish in OU. As far as I know, Dragapult is more viable but Dracovish is certainly more broken.

Could you provide us with a team you've made and explain the thought behind it?

:kyurem-black: :eternatus: :zacian-crowned: :necrozma-dusk-mane: :rotom-wash: :blissey: (click for import)
This is a Kyurem Black balance which I built for UPL, for my Semifinals game vs Reje. Reje was up until this point a balance goon, so KB would perform well vs him in theory. The rationale behind this team is that every (balance) team has one of two Zacian counters, Quagsire or NDM. Teams which have Quagsire won't have NDM, so KB will be able to tear it up, and teams which have NDM won't have quagsire so one of KB or Zacian can setup up to break through NDM allowing the other one to sweep. Washtom is the best fogger imo, to improve the HO MU. In the end, Reje did bring screens and defeated me, but I think if I played more optimally, eg volt switching on Mew with washtom turn 1, this game was winnable.

2. This is a pretty tough question since they're all so extreme but:
  1. Kyurem Black, if it gets a free DD and the opposing Zacian has taken rocks damage + NDM (if they even have one) is slightly chipped, it literally is Gg. No escaping it unless you have Magearna or Zamazenta or something (unmons), and so it forces you to bend over backwards to make sure it cannot DD. Eg: You can't afford to defog on those stacked spikes on your side with Rotom-Wash, lest KB come in. why can this dyna. Good in weather MUs
  2. Gyarados, late game becomes exceptionally hard to contain it from snowballing, even washtom is not reliable due to power whip. Quag is setup fodder for taunt unless you get the 30%. Good in HO MUs
  3. Excadrill, all good teams pack a check but it's not too hard for it to muscle past them bc of Max Phantasm. Good in HO MUs
  4. Dragapult, more so in the builder, Most common defensive cores struggle, their best counterplay being TTar/Mandibuzz/Quag, quagbuzz get broken and ttar is easy to force rest on. Sets up on corvi, bliss, washtom and just puts a lot of pressure on stuff like dm, forcing them out to land a free DD. Good vs Rain and Sun
  5. Charizard, Sun teams are quite restricted and it won't be breaking ttar + washtom or etern/bliss/other special wall teams. It does 2HKO blissey, and it is still insane, but not as much as the above imo.
  6. Volcarona is overrated imo
  7. Cinderace, good, literally the bane of all ladder teams I build but it's relatively hard to fit and bring into a position for it to dyna and claim 2.
3. Rocky Helmet is amazing, but it's just hard to run on NDM who would be the best user because of this calc:
+1 252+ Atk Zacian-Crowned Close Combat vs. 252 HP / 252+ Def Necrozma-Dusk-Mane: 160-189 (40.2 - 47.4%) -- 2.3% chance to 2HKO after Stealth Rock
(Minimum chip + Rocks or a Spike and it may be over.)
+1 252+ Atk Zacian-Crowned Close Combat vs. 252 HP / 144+ Def Necrozma-Dusk-Mane: 174-205 (43.7 - 51.5%) -- 64.5% chance to 2HKO after Stealth Rock
(TWave DM spread - needs lefties)
As for other defensive mons, eg Quag, Shed Shell or HDB is kind of a must. As it stands, helmet is more of a luxury item to have. I guess steel birds can fit it as their main item slot though, if goth isn't a worry.

4. Most ladder players usually build weird mishmashes of teams, I think when building for this meta, you have to choose a playstyle and stick with it. Oftentimes I see a random Grimmsnarl on a balance on the ladder, Webs with defensive walls (s/o Ackesh) or Melmetal, Darm G, Mewtwo, Marshadow, Zamazenta-Crowned (worst offender) and Cinderace being incredibly overused when other options would just do better. Also, I try to account for playstyles in the builder as well as individual mons. If I have a good MU vs screens, all weathers, and have wincons vs fat balance, the classic switchins for threats (zac, ground resist, tspike absorber, fight resist, special wall... etc) then I'm happy with the team

5. Defensive mons like Ho-Oh, Lugia, Zygarde-C and Giratina are nice to have. Lando T and Kart returning are nice to have too, as they'd be absolutely nuts with Dynamax, and so a full dyna ban would be implemented hopefully lol

5. I really like Megas and wish there were more, Z moves are nice too although I don't really mind them being gone. As for megas in conjunction with Dynamax, its probably an interaction never intended to happen. Unfortunately I don't think Megas will return this gen, and any gen where Dynamax returns, I don't see Z moves or Megas returning, Natdex basically created mechanics which would be likely to happen and intuitive (not letting Z movers dynamax, not letting Megas dynamax based off of the Rayquaza Z Move and Dragon Ascent interaction). Either way, Dynamax utterly outclasses Z moves, and makes them largely useless except on very specific cases (Ultra Necrozma, or wanting to preserve the Dyna for a different sweeper - generally on HO). And the best Dynamaxers are better than every mega by far except MRay.
